Quantification of promoting efficiency and reducing toxicity of Traditional Chinese Medicine: A case study of the combination of Tripterygium wilfordii hook. f. and Lysimachia christinae hance in the treatment of lung cancer

Tra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) usually acts in the form of compound prescriptions in the treatment of complex diseases.
